Performs restricted mean survival time (RMST) analysis for comparing survival distributions between groups. RMST provides a clinically meaningful measure of survival benefit by estimating the area under the survival curve up to a specific time point (tau), representing the average survival time within the restriction period.
Usage
rmst(
  data,
  elapsedtime,
  outcome,
  explanatory,
  outcomeLevel = "1",
  tau_method = "auto",
  tau_value = 365,
  tau_percentile = 80,
  confidence_level = 0.95,
  bootstrap_ci = FALSE,
  bootstrap_n = 1000,
  show_rmst_table = TRUE,
  show_rmst_plot = TRUE,
  show_difference_test = TRUE,
  show_ratio_test = FALSE,
  show_tau_analysis = FALSE,
  showSummaries = FALSE,
  showExplanations = FALSE
)Arguments
- data
- The data as a data frame. 
- elapsedtime
- Time variable for survival analysis 
- outcome
- Event indicator variable 
- explanatory
- Grouping variable for comparison 
- outcomeLevel
- Level of the outcome variable that represents the event of interest. 
- tau_method
- Method for selecting the restriction time tau. 
- tau_value
- Manual specification of restriction time tau (used when method is 'manual'). 
- tau_percentile
- Percentile of maximum follow-up time to use as tau (used when method is 'percentile'). 
- confidence_level
- Confidence level for all confidence intervals. 
- bootstrap_ci
- Use bootstrap method for confidence intervals (more robust for small samples). 
- bootstrap_n
- Number of bootstrap iterations for confidence interval estimation. 
- show_rmst_table
- Display table with RMST estimates and confidence intervals by group. 
- show_rmst_plot
- Display survival curves with highlighted RMST areas. 
- show_difference_test
- Perform statistical test for difference in RMST between groups. 
- show_ratio_test
- Perform statistical test for ratio of RMST between groups. 
- show_tau_analysis
- Display sensitivity analysis across different tau values. 
- showSummaries
- Generate natural language summary of results. 
- showExplanations
- Show detailed methodology explanations. 
Value
A results object containing:
| results$todo | a html | ||||
| results$rmstTable | a table | ||||
| results$comparisonTable | a table | ||||
| results$rmstPlot | an image | ||||
| results$tauAnalysisPlot | an image | ||||
| results$tauAnalysisTable | a table | ||||
| results$analysisSummary | a html | ||||
| results$methodExplanation | a html | 
Tables can be converted to data frames with asDF or as.data.frame. For example:
results$rmstTable$asDF
as.data.frame(results$rmstTable)
